Transaction d3f2884437d412eb3e328ec775b61059621d2ab59739a056b558963388e798c3
1 Input
1 Output
-
d3f2884437d412eb3e328ec775b61059621d2ab59739a056b558963388e798c3:0
- value
- 1155107
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34523525a10ceee2c3c0478ad603a0abfe6f1dc2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15mecrsB8kgpSpNXwdXPYK7Yj8fhDruGUB